Hi,
I look for a convient way to use \appendtoks with a token list
which is accessed with \csname ... \endcsname, e.g.
\appendtoks something \to\csname mytoks\endcsname
This works when I enclose the \csname/\endcsname pair in braces
\appendtoks something \to{\csname mytoks\endcsname}
